A few thoughts ... in the original world, Bernd Doppler marries Claudia and is Regina's father, Peter marries Bernadette and finds true love, Woller marries Hannah (he had a crush on her for ever) and they have a child on the way, which can't be Jonas as Mikkel never existed, Regina finally lives, and it seems that her and Katharina (if that's still her name now) are still single. Interestingly, HG's son and daughter-in-law, Marek and Sonja, can be said to be the true incarnations of Jonas and Hannah. Sonja is an anagram of Jonas and the first few letters in MARek TAnnhaus's name almost spell MARThA. It's fascinating to realise that HG invented time travel to save his son's family and technically, after an infinite amount of time ... IT WORKED! Although, of course, he'll never realise it... Edit: Jonas's words to Marek also have two meanings: "The bridge is closed ... there was an accident." The Einstein-Rosen bridge is closed and the accident was HG Tannhaus triggering his machine.
